A high-velocity jet of ionized gas, or plasma, is used in CNC plasma cutting, a precision metal production technique, to cut through electrically conductive materials. Since CNC plasma cutting depends on electrical conductivity, a wide variety of materials are appropriate for the process, with a primary emphasis on metals. The most often used metals are mild steel, stainless steel, and aluminum. Mild steel is used because to its low cost and ease of cutting, stainless steel because of its resistance to corrosion and beautiful finish, and aluminum because of its lightweight nature and adaptability to a variety of industries.
In addition to these, additional conductive metals including brass, copper, and titanium may be cut using CNC plasma cutting; however, some of these require specific configurations because of variations in their melting temperatures and thermal conductivity. The method is perfect for industrial fabrication, automobile parts, building components, and creative metalwork since it is very efficient at cutting sheets, plates, and even thicker metal pieces. The thickness of the material has a big impact on the cutting quality and speed; thinner sheets cut cleanly and fast, whereas thicker materials could need more passes or stronger plasma torches.
The final edge's sharpness and cutting efficiency can be affected by surface quality, metal alloy composition, and the presence of coatings like paint or galvanization. Because the computer-controlled technique guarantees uniformity across several components, CNC plasma cutting is especially beneficial for complicated designs, complex forms, and repeated patterns. Cutting materials with different textures and hardness is now possible thanks to advancements in CNC plasma technology, increasing the potential for both ornamental and useful metal items.
